Динамические эффекты с помощью :hover [13/18] Теория


#21

Да, строчный тег tr, поэтому по идее необходимо ставить его… Спасибо!..:slight_smile:


#22

Я не сомневаюсь. А в первом правиле что написано?
Расшифруйте эту запись, пожалуйста:
td:hover em {
display: inline;
}


#23

Здравствуйте.
Подскажите какое значение имеет вот это строка в html-редакторе:

<style>
        em { display: none; }
    </style>

em здесь это тег? Почему тогда без скобок и зачем прописывается в css-коде:

tr:hover em {
display: inline;

}

Ведь em не дочерний элемент tr


#24

Em в данном случае - это селектор, поэтому без скобок.
Расскажите, какие элементы являются дочерними на ваш взгляд.


#25

Скорее всего мои знания неполные, может путаю, но ведь селекторы прописываются в css коде, а там в html.
В моём понимании em это дочерний элемент style.


#26

В html-коде тоже могут быть написаны css-правила - внутри тега style.
Селектор никак не может быть дочерним элементом тега. Не путайте, пожалуйста.


#27

Надо повторить. Нет систематизации знаний в голове.
Спасибо! А вы наставник в академии?


#28

Нет. Я просто активист этого форума.


#29

Я бы предложил дописать в условие подсказку/подсказку - (на любую часть строки) - сам споткнулся и добавил td - работает же))